A robust view of the data

Median and central nutrient ranges per 100 grams

The central range runs from the 10th to the 90th percentile of the records on this page. The observed minimum and maximum are included for transparency, but the middle interval is generally more useful for seeing the collection without letting one extreme record dominate.

NutrientMedianCentral 80%Observed spanRecords
Caloriesper 100 g117 kcal98 kcal–164 kcal38 kcal–289 kcal99
Proteinper 100 g2.7 g2.1 g–6.4 g1.1 g–13.8 g99
Carbohydrateper 100 g20.8 g15.5 g–25.3 g6.9 g–53.6 g99
Total fatper 100 g2.5 g0.3 g–6.8 g0.1 g–17.2 g99
Dietary fiberper 100 g1.1 g0.4 g–1.9 g0.1 g–5.8 g99
Total sugarsper 100 g0.8 g0.2 g–1.6 g0 g–31.1 g99
Sodiumper 100 g199 mg165 mg–437 mg7 mg–959 mg99
Potassiumper 100 g100 mg60 mg–191 mg33 mg–256 mg99
Calciumper 100 g15 mg8 mg–37 mg3 mg–112 mg99
Ironper 100 g0.9 mg0.5 mg–1.5 mg0.4 mg–2.3 mg99

All rows use the same 100-gram denominator and values from the cited records. The interval is descriptive, not a recommended intake range or statistical confidence interval.

Portion context

Household measures answer a different question than 100 grams.

99 of 99 records (100%) include at least one named measure in the source data. Together those records provide 105 usable named measures.

Across the pooled named measures, the midpoint gram weight is 191 g. The central 10th-to-90th-percentile interval runs from 160 g to 257 g, while the complete observed span is 10–486 g. This pooled summary mixes different measure types, so it is a navigation aid rather than a suggested portion.

A cup, slice, piece, sandwich, fillet, or fluid ounce can represent a different amount of food. Even two measures with the same label may have different gram weights across records. Open the closest profile and use its listed weight instead of transferring a measure from another record.

USDA’s representative source amount is also not necessarily what a visitor ate. For equal-weight comparison, use the 100-gram table. For meal estimation, match the exact description first, then match the amount, and finally account for additions or preparation details absent from the selected record.

Boundaries and provenance

What this collection can—and cannot—tell you.

This page summarizes USDA FoodData Central Survey Foods (FNDDS) records from 2021–2023, published 2024-10-31. FNDDS supplies standardized reference descriptions used to represent foods reported in dietary surveys. Each value on this page remains tied to one exact FDC record; the complete catalog provides direct links so the source can be checked rather than taken on trust.

The records are not laboratory measurements of every possible “Rice mixed dishes” preparation. Restaurant recipes change, packaged products are reformulated, homemade ingredient ratios vary, and cooking can change water weight. A photo also cannot reliably reveal every hidden ingredient or gram weight. The robust range describes variation among the records selected for this topic, not uncertainty around a single meal.

The median is not a default calorie count. The 10th and 90th percentiles are not lower and upper recommendations. The minimum and maximum are not promises that every real version falls inside the observed span. These statistics are tools for navigating a source collection while keeping the denominator, record name, and normal recipe variation visible.
